Does Your Salary Stop You Getting Rich?

 

What is your salary?

  • Security
  • Endorsement by your company
  • A promise of holiday and sick pay
  • The easiest way to get paid - no tax/SL calculations
  • A representation of the value of your time

What if we looked at it a different way?

What is your salary?

  • An annual cap on your potential
  • Gives responsibility for your worth to someone else
  • A reason to maintain the status quo
  • A system designed to pay you last
  • You are selling your time, but on someone else's terms

You need soft skills to get a decent raise

  • Comfortable talking to your boss and negotiating
  • Shout about what makes you special
  • (Make yourself special)
  • Convey your own worth
  • Be confident in your authority

In the UK most people aren't comfortable with this because a salary isn't seen as a business transaction.

This week I set up a client with a React developer who charges £400/day

£400 * 5 (days) * 4 (weeks) * 10 (months) =

£80,000

With two months holiday 🛫

Why do I care what you do?

I think the way many people in the UK view their salary, a gift from their employer, is unhealthy.

You are selling your time (sometimes your entire working life) to a company - do you want to leave it up to them to determine what that's worth?

Things you should do

  • Start viewing your salary as a transaction between equal parties
  • Sell your time for what it's worth (not what you think it's worth)
  • Develop the soft skills you need to get what you deserve as an employee or freelancer/contractor
  • Take an active role in raising or removing your ceiling of potential
